Troubleshooting the Takeuchi TL-130 Skid Steer
#1
The Takeuchi TL-130 is a compact track loader that has earned a reputation for its reliability and performance in challenging environments. It is commonly used in construction, landscaping, and agricultural applications due to its superior lifting capacity, stability, and versatility. However, like all heavy machinery, the TL-130 can encounter various issues that require attention to ensure optimal performance. This article explores some of the common problems associated with the Takeuchi TL-130, provides troubleshooting steps, and offers practical solutions to help keep the machine operating smoothly.
Overview of the Takeuchi TL-130
Takeuchi is a Japanese manufacturer known for producing high-quality construction equipment, including compact track loaders and mini excavators. The TL-130 is a part of their line of track loaders and features a 98 horsepower engine, which provides robust power for heavy lifting and material handling tasks. The TL-130’s rubber track system ensures stability and traction on a wide range of surfaces, making it ideal for both rough terrains and urban environments.
The TL-130 is equipped with advanced hydraulic systems, a spacious operator cab, and a range of attachments, which makes it a highly versatile machine. However, as with any equipment, the machine may experience issues after prolonged use or if it isn’t properly maintained. Below are some common issues that operators may encounter with the Takeuchi TL-130.
Common Issues and Solutions
1. Hydraulic System Failures
Hydraulic issues are among the most common problems faced by owners of the Takeuchi TL-130. These issues can manifest in several ways, including slow arm or bucket movements, lack of power to attachments, or even complete hydraulic failure. Common causes of hydraulic problems include:
  • Low Hydraulic Fluid Levels: Low fluid levels can lead to a drop in hydraulic pressure, which results in reduced performance of the hydraulic systems. Always check the fluid level and top off if necessary.
  • Contaminated Hydraulic Fluid: If the hydraulic fluid becomes contaminated with dirt, debris, or moisture, it can cause the hydraulic system to malfunction, leading to wear on seals and pumps. Regularly change the hydraulic fluid and replace filters as recommended by the manufacturer.
  • Worn Hydraulic Pump or Motor: Over time, the hydraulic pump or motor can become worn out due to excessive use or lack of maintenance. This can cause the loader’s lift arms to operate slowly or fail altogether.
Solution: To address hydraulic issues, start by checking the fluid levels and topping off if needed. If the problem persists, inspect the hydraulic pump and motor for wear and tear. Replace the damaged components as necessary. Ensure that you are using the correct type of hydraulic fluid and perform regular fluid and filter changes.
2. Engine Overheating or Stalling
Engine performance issues, such as overheating or stalling, are also common in the Takeuchi TL-130. These issues can arise from various factors, including poor airflow, fuel delivery problems, and cooling system malfunctions. Common causes include:
  • Clogged Air Filters: If the air filter is clogged with dust or dirt, the engine will not receive the necessary airflow, which can cause it to overheat or stall. In dusty environments, the air filter should be checked and replaced more frequently.
  • Radiator and Cooling System Blockages: Dirt, debris, and coolant buildup can restrict airflow to the radiator, causing the engine to overheat. Periodically cleaning the radiator and checking for blockages can prevent this issue.
  • Fuel Delivery Problems: If the fuel filter is clogged or the fuel pump is malfunctioning, the engine may not receive the proper fuel supply, leading to stalling. Fuel delivery issues should be inspected and addressed promptly.
Solution: Start by cleaning or replacing the air filter if it’s clogged. Ensure that the radiator is clean and free of obstructions to improve airflow. Check the fuel system for blockages or issues and replace the fuel filter if necessary. Regular maintenance of these components can prevent overheating and engine stalling.
3. Track Issues
As a tracked machine, the Takeuchi TL-130’s performance is heavily dependent on the condition of its tracks. Track problems are relatively common in tracked loaders, especially when used on rough or uneven terrain. Some common track-related issues include:
  • Track Tension Problems: Incorrect track tension can cause uneven wear, poor traction, and reduced stability. Overly tight tracks can lead to excess strain on the drive system, while loose tracks can cause the machine to lose traction.
  • Track Wear and Damage: Prolonged use on rough terrain can lead to wear and damage to the tracks, such as cracks or tears in the rubber.
Solution: Regularly check the track tension and adjust it according to the manufacturer’s guidelines. If the tracks are too tight or loose, they should be re-tensioned to the correct specifications. Inspect the tracks for signs of wear or damage, and replace them if necessary. Using the machine on smooth surfaces as much as possible will help extend the lifespan of the tracks.
4. Electrical Issues
Electrical problems can be another source of frustration for Takeuchi TL-130 operators. These issues can include problems with the ignition system, the battery, or electrical connections. Common symptoms of electrical issues include failure to start, intermittent electrical malfunctions, or flickering lights on the dashboard.
  • Battery Issues: A weak or dead battery can prevent the machine from starting. If the battery terminals are corroded or the battery itself is old, it may need to be replaced.
  • Blown Fuses: Fuses can blow due to power surges or electrical short circuits, causing various electrical systems to fail. Regularly inspect the fuses and replace them as necessary.
  • Wiring Problems: Over time, the wiring in the TL-130 can become damaged or worn, especially in areas where the cables are exposed to friction or harsh conditions.
Solution: Begin by checking the battery and cleaning the terminals to ensure proper connections. If the battery is old or faulty, replace it. Inspect the fuses and wiring for any visible signs of damage, and replace any blown fuses or damaged wiring. Ensuring that electrical components are well-maintained and free from corrosion will prevent future electrical failures.
5. Loader Arm or Bucket Issues
Another issue operators might encounter with the TL-130 involves problems with the loader arms or bucket. These issues can include sluggish movements, difficulty lifting heavy loads, or jerky operation. The most common causes of such issues are:
  • Hydraulic Cylinder Leaks: If the hydraulic cylinders on the loader arms or bucket are leaking, it can lead to a loss of power and slow movements. Inspect the hydraulic cylinders for leaks and replace any seals that are damaged.
  • Linkage Problems: Over time, the linkage mechanisms that connect the loader arms and bucket can wear or become misaligned, affecting their ability to lift and move materials smoothly.
Solution: Inspect the hydraulic cylinders for leaks and replace any worn-out seals or damaged components. Check the linkage for proper alignment and lubrication, and replace any worn parts that may be causing difficulty in operation. Regular lubrication and timely repairs are essential for maintaining smooth loader arm and bucket movements.
